教会你轻松Linux网卡安装
原创轻松Linux网卡安装指南
在Linux系统中,网卡是连接计算机与网络的关键设备。正确安装和配置网卡是确保网络连接稳定的基础。本文将为您详细介绍怎样在Linux系统中轻松安装网卡。
一、检查当前网卡状态
在安装网卡之前,首先需要检查当前系统中的网卡状态。以下是几种常用的检查方法:
1. 使用ifconfig命令
ifconfig
运行上述命令后,您将看到系统中所有网卡的详细信息,包括IP地址、子网掩码、MAC地址等。
2. 使用ip命令
ip addr show
ip命令是ifconfig命令的替代品,它提供了更为多彩的功能。运行上述命令后,您将看到与ifconfig类似的网卡信息。
二、安装网卡驱动
在Linux系统中,大多数网卡驱动都包含在内核中,无需额外安装。但是,对于某些特殊网卡或较旧的系统,也许需要手动安装驱动。
1. 使用包管理器安装驱动
大多数Linux发行版都提供了包管理器,如apt(Debian/Ubuntu)、yum(CentOS/RHEL)等。您可以使用以下命令查找并安装相应的网卡驱动:
Debian/Ubuntu系统:
sudo apt-get install [驱动名称]
CentOS/RHEL系统:
sudo yum install [驱动名称]
请将[驱动名称]替换为您需要安装的网卡驱动名称。
2. 手动编译和安装驱动
如果您需要安装不在官方仓库中的驱动,可以按照以下步骤进行:
- 下载驱动源码包。
- 解压源码包。
- 进入源码目录,运行以下命令编译驱动:
- 运行以下命令安装驱动:
- 按照提示完成安装过程。
sudo make
sudo make install
三、配置网卡
安装驱动后,您需要配置网卡,使其能够正常连接到网络。以下是一些常见的配置方法:
1. 编辑网络配置文件
大多数Linux系统使用NetworkManager管理网络配置。您可以使用以下命令编辑网络配置文件:
sudo nano /etc/netplan/01-netcfg.yaml
在文件中,您可以设置网卡的IP地址、子网掩码、网关等信息。配置完成后,保存并关闭文件。
2. 应用网络配置
配置文件编辑完成后,运行以下命令应用网络配置:
sudo netplan apply
如果配置正确,您的计算机将自动连接到网络。
3. 使用nmcli命令行工具
nmcli是一个命令行工具,用于管理NetworkManager配置。您可以使用以下命令配置网卡:
sudo nmcli con mod [连接名称] ifname [网卡名称] ipv4.addresses [IP地址]/[子网掩码] ipv4.gateway [网关] ipv4.method manual
请将[连接名称]、[网卡名称]、[IP地址]、[子网掩码]和[网关]替换为您需要配置的值。
四、验证网络连接
配置完成后,您可以使用以下方法验证网络连接:
1. 使用ping命令
ping [目标地址]
如果您能够顺利ping通目标地址,说明您的网络连接已经正常。
2. 使用curl命令
curl [目标地址]
如果您能够顺利访问目标地址,说明您的网络连接已经正常。
五、总结
通过以上步骤,您可以在Linux系统中轻松安装和配置网卡。在安装过程中,请确保按照实际需求选择合适的驱动和配置方法。祝您使用愉快!